Category: GNU/Linux

03

终于把slackware 13.1安装上了

昨天所有的考试都考完了,一高兴就把ubuntu删了装了Slackware。之前在VirturalBox里面模拟安装了好几遍,稍微熟悉了一点。其实Slackware安装挺简单的。
主要步骤也就是:

  1. 用优盘boot,选择鼠标和键盘类型(或者直接Enter),root登录
  2. 由于安装Ubuntu的时候已经分好区了,所以分区就省了。mount上下载在D盘的安装光盘1的镜像文件。
  3. setup,分配swap,分配挂载/的空间
  4. 选择相应的软件,安装lilo
  5. Ok了。

我都Gnome比较有爱,所以我没有安装KDE。mount第2个光盘镜像,安装里面的X,再上网,然后一条命令:

lynx --source http://gnomeslackbuild.org/net-install | bash

然后就看世界杯去了,看完了上半场就已经安装好了。然后执行

xwmconfig

选择xinitrc.gnome,重启然后

startx

gnome就安装好了。

0
comments

17

介绍一个常用Linux发行版下载网站

用Ubuntu有一段时间了,想换一个新的Linux发行版。在四处逛的时候发现了Slackware,幸好Slackware五月二十四出了新的版本13.1。官方的ftp里面没有找到镜像文件(可能是我没有找到),在Google上搜到一个下载站找到了相应的镜像文件。http://darkstar.ist.utl.pt/ 里面不仅有Slackware的镜像文件还有fedora、gentoo、arch Linux、ubuntu等发行版的下载。也可以以ftp方式登入。

0
comments

28

Linux下下载整个网站

前一段时间封杀BT听说很多人把VeryCD整站下载,没想到今天我也要下载多个页面。不过我要下载的是google app engine中文文档。Google app engine有中文的文档,但是google提供的下载却是英文版的(不知道是不是我没发现)。废话少说,开始把:

  1. 我们要利用wget下载,如果没有的话到源里面找一个吧。windows用户自己去baigle一下吧。
  2. 我在我的主文件夹里面新建了一个gaedocCN的文件夹
  3. 打开终端 $cd ~/gaedocCN
  4. $wget -r -p -np -k http://code.google.com/intl/zh-CN/appengine/
  5. 回车开始下载。OK了。中文的GAE文档就躺在那里了。

在Ubuntu下成功。

如果用windows的话还是找别的工具吧。

0
comments

01

ubuntu下安装eclipse开发jsp

这几天一直在捣鼓eclipse,想安装一个可以高亮和自动提示的插件Lomboz。真tmd费事啊,折腾了两三天还是没弄好。我的eclipse是从新立得里面自动安装的,3.5版本,以前安装过一个pydev的插件成功了,但是安装Lomboz时却失败了。网上说是eclipse的版本要和lomboz一致,可是lomboz最新版是3.3。没办法,只好把eclipse3.5卸了。下了一个all-in-one安装上了。

1、在这里下载http://lomboz.ow2.org/downloads/R-3.3_index.php 。可以下载别人配置好的eclipse3.3版省得配置了,Linux版为http://forge.objectweb.org/project/download.php?group_id=97&file_id=9304 里面还要mac和windows版的。

2、解压 $sudo tar -zxvf ./org.objectweb.lomboz-all-in-one-R-3.3-200710290621-linux-gtk.tar.gz       解压生成一个eclipse文件夹

3、移动到/opt文件夹下,$sudo mv ./eclipse /opt/        把解压的eclipse文件夹移动到/opt目录下,当然不移动也可以,如果你不嫌目录下文件夹多得话

4、新建面板启动,在面板上右键单击,选择添加到面板->自定义应用程序起动器,名称为eclipse,命令为/opt/eclipse/eclipse,图标可以在/opt/eclipse下面选择icon.xpm。这样就可以点击面板上的图标启动eclipse了,默认已经安装好了lomboz,当然还有其他得插件。

0
comments

30

ubuntu10.04发布了

可能火星了,不过还是要发一篇文章纪念一下

下载地址为http://www.ubuntu.com/getubuntu/download

选择区域后就可以下载了,我就不凑热闹了,现凑合着用9.10,呵呵。其实都一样,用着爽就行。

希望可以和ubuntu的爱好者交流一下,嘻嘻。

0
comments

24

vim入门2──《vim book》笔记

《vim book》笔记
查找字符串
/字符串,例如要查找include,就输入/include,然后回车即可。其中*[]^%/\?~$有特殊的意义,如果想用这些符号的话必须转义。例如,当想查找*时输入/\*即可。如果想继续查找的话输入/然后回车即可或者按n命令,向上搜索用?命令。另外vim也可以记住你说查询的内容如果懒得输入如用输入/然后按向上的健就可以查看以前的输入和shell一样。

高亮查找到的字符串 :set hlsearch
取消查找高亮 :set nohlsearch
取消当前的查找高亮 :nohlsearch
增量查找 :set incsearch(不等你按回车就查找)
取消增量查找 :set noincsearch

正则表达式
搜索时可以使用正则表达式例如搜索以let开头的行可以输入/^let,以all结束的行可以用/all$,具体的正则表达式的使用可以参考http://www.regexlab.com/zh/regref.htm 的介绍。

0
comments

24

Linux下Shell编程起步3

《Beginning Linux Programming》读书笔记

条件判断:

判断用test或[

( Read more )

0
comments

24

ubuntu下安装tomcat6

由于要学习jsp,今天安装tomcat,首先在新立得里面把tomcat6标上安装。然后上网查找怎么配置,网上很多的,在这里我不说怎么配置环境变量。我想说的是网上的很多都是说安装tomcat5.5的。我以为和tomcat6应该类似就运行sudo /usr/share/tomcat6/bin/startup.sh 来start tomcat,貌似成功了,但是访问localhost:8180不成功。关闭是也没成功提示

2010-4-24 13:03:56 org.apache.catalina.startup.Catalina stopServer
严重: Catalina.stop:
java.io.FileNotFoundException: /usr/share/tomcat6/conf/server.xml (No such file or directory)
at java.io.FileInputStream.open(Native Method)

( Read more )

0
comments

22

Linux下Shell编程起步2

《Beginning Linux Programming》笔记

变量
Shell脚本里面的变量说明和其他的脚本语言一样简单
$ what=Hello\ World
$ echo $what
显示结果为:Hello World
或:
$ what=”Hello World”
$ echo $what

获取输入
$ read string
aaa
$ echo $string
aaa
( Read more )

0
comments

20

Linux下Shell编程起步1

看到一本书不错《Begining Linux Programming》,其中的Shell编程比较浅显易懂。本来想从图书馆借来看看,但是没有剩余了。于是就白天在图书馆看,回到宿舍下载了英文版的来看。外国人写的书有一点非常好,基本都有pdf格式的,而且不是扫描版800多页的书才7.7MB。学习Shell编程就用它了。下面的代码来自该书。

第一个小例子:

————————————————-

#!/bin/sh

#http://www.zhangshine.com/

for file in *

do

if grep -q POSIX $file

then

echo $file

fi

done

exit 0

————————————————–

这个小例子的作用是寻找文件里面有”POSIX”字符串的文件并打印出来文件名。这个脚本还是比较简单的。第一行#!好像念作“sha-bang”,第一行用来说明这个文件的解释器。除此之外的以#开头的都是注释。如果你有Python基础或Java基础剩下的就很容易理解了。其中比较有意思的一个是if语句以if结束(不知道应不应该这么说),开始只是猜测看到case语句时发现case语句以esac结束,是不是比较有意思。在我机器上的执行结果为

——————————————————

zs@zhangs-laptop:~/shell$ ./grepPOSIX.sh

grepPOSIX.sh

os.txt

——————————————————-

每天一点点,积少成多。

 

0
comments